Description
This announcement is a Request for Information (RFI) only. The United States Army Corps of Engineers, Afghanistan Engineer District South (USACE-AES), Kandahar, Afghanistan is seeking preliminary marketing information from capable and reliable sources. The proposed requirement is to obtain a Commercial Airline Service for round trip air transportation from Kandahar Air Field (KAF) to Dubai, UAE. The Contractor providing such services would provide aircrafts which are certified as follows: International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O), Civil Aviation Authority (CAA), or U.S. Federal Aviation (FAA). The contractor is obligated to comply with generally accepted standards of airmanship, training, maintenance practices and procedures. The contractor shall identify if their aircrafts are Commercial Airlift Review Board (CARB) certified from the United States Transportation Command (USTRANSCOM) in accordance with DoD Direction 4500.53, dated 2 December 2010 as well as Fly American Act, 49 USC 40118, and CRAF Act, 49 USC 41106. This effort is classified through the North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) under 481111, Scheduled Charter Passenger Air Transportation.
